Transaction 1843e24115b726fd442427b750030d40c140e20240804fdff79c613460873f86

2 Input
2 Outputs
  • 1843e24115b726fd442427b750030d40c140e20240804fdff79c613460873f86:0
  • value  8857
    address  19ad4jnAQzPVTXr2NbWHK545otHdXpN9gq
  • 1843e24115b726fd442427b750030d40c140e20240804fdff79c613460873f86:1
  • value  69176102
    address  32sFfYJWddPPwG4pZEtQGCdT6wYq4Mmh6V